   Kinetic Study of Photocatalytic Degradation of Several Pharmaceuticals Assisted by SiO2/ TiO2 Catalyst in Solar Bath System

چکیده    The photo-catalytic degradation of five pharmaceuticals using tio2 modified with sio2, and sun light was monitored. the initial concentrations used in the solar bath system were100 µg/l for caffeine, diclofenac, glimepiride and ibuprofen, and 25 µg/l for methotrexate. kinetic disappearance of caffeine, diclofenac, glimepiride and ibuprofen shows pseudo- first order kinetics, while methotrexate shows a zero order kinetic degradation which was monitored using hplc/uv at λ = 225 nm, f = 1ml/min and on a c8 reversed phase column. the rate constants for diclofenac (wastewater 0.3238 sec-1, distilled water 0.4057 sec-1), glimepiride (wastewater 0.2203 sec-1, distilled water 0.2771 sec-1), ibuprofen (wastewater 0.2802 sec-1, distilled water 0.2411 sec-1), caffeine (distilled water 0.416 sec-1) and methotrexate (distilled water 3.1407 mole l-1 sec-1). the removal efficiency for the drugs was ranged between 79% and 96%.
